WELLS v. OLSTEN CORP.

No. 25281-3-II.

15 P.3d 652 (2001)

104 Wash.App. 135

Priscilla WELLS, Appellant, v. OLSTEN CORPORATION, Respondent.

Court of Appeals of Washington, Division 2.

January 5, 2001.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Amy L. Arvidson, Seattle, for Respondent.

Steven L. Busick, Vancouver, for Appellant.


SEINFELD, J.

Priscilla Wells filed an industrial insurance claim, seeking compensation for an injury she suffered while working for Olsten Corporation. After an industrial insurance appeals judge issued a proposed order closing the claim, Wells twice sought to extend the time to petition for review.
